University staff member wins prestigious Match Official of the Year Award

University of Edinburgh Sport & Exercise, Business Development Manager, Ollie Cruickshank has been awarded the Wheelchair Rugby Match Official of the Year Award.

This month Sport & Exercise team member, Ollie Cruickshank was awarded the Wheelchair Rugby Match Official of the Year award for the 2022 season. Throughout the 2022 season Ollie took charge of 35 fixtures including being the lead referee for the Challenge cup final and a referee for the Super League Grand Final.

Following the conclusion of the domestic season Ollie travelled to the Rugby League World Cup where he was the Lead referee in 4 matches including the World Cup Final between England and France. Ollie commented on his achievement saying:

“It is great to be recognised for my performances last season. The standard of officiating is going up each year so I was delighted just to be nominated for this award. To pick up the award is a great way to draw the 2022 season to a close.”

 

Ollie began refereeing for Wheelchair Rugby League back in 2015 and moved into international refereeing when stepping up to cover an absence during the Celtic Cup held in Stirling in 2017. Since then Ollie has become an established referee within the community. Speaking of Ollie’s success, Martin Coyd OBE, Chair of the Wheelchair Rugby League said:

“Ollie has had an exceptional year as a Match Official in Wheelchair Rugby League.  This variant of the game is exceptionally quick and has three times as many play the balls as the running variant over the 80 minutes.  Ollie has been officiating for only a few short years but has established himself at the top of the game in the British Isles”.
